Ok, so I can see what the others are reporting regarding the stop/start. It does seem to shutdown before coming to a full stop, but at the point it shuts down the autohold is taking over and stopping the car. It will take a few days to get used to but dont think its an issue?
The gear changing with 6,7,8 is odd though. Doing 70 in 8 and lift off, go to lightly feather the pedal and it drops down to 7 with noticable rev change. Having just jumpped out of the t3 it is instantly noticable. I am sure you could be doing 60 in 8 and still pull away in the t3 without it sulking and droppping gears.
I mentioned this to the dealer when i went back for my sunglases I had left in the t3 and he suggested I give it a week and see how i get on, let him know when I go back for my other key and then maybe go out in the managers car to see if there is any diffrence. (There wont be as its the same build)
